How to Customize Projects in SwiftXR

Learn how to create customized projects in SwiftXR

Imagine having to rebuild a new project from scratch every time you want to make a variant of an already existing project. That is needless work that can be taken care of with customization.

Product customization on SwiftXR enables you to create one project that you can tweak, configure and customize to suit your preference without having to rebuild.

This ensures that you don’t waste time duplicating or rebuilding experiences every time you require a small change on a project, while still keeping the core experience intact.

Here’s a step-by step guide to customizing your project on SwiftXR.

Variant Customization

This allows you to customize your product look in terms of material texture and colour.

It is especially useful for sales demonstrations, product launches, etc. to showcase variants of products.

Step 1: Go to Customization Options

Start by clicking Properties > Customization Options > Enable.

Step 2: Customize material

From here, you can decide to customize any part of the product. To do so, click the “Material” drop down and choose the part of the product to customize.

Then go to “Material Colour” and click on the colour you want in the colour scheme, and it will automatically change to the preferred colour.

Step 3: Add New Variant

If you are satisfied with this customization variant, you can add a new variant, by clicking “Add New Variant” and keep going till you are done.

Best Practices

  • Rename your materials for easy use next time

  • If your material does not have a white texture, don’t use colour, rather apply another texture as a variant.

Background Customization

You can also decide to change the background colour of the project to suit your brand colour. Simply go to Design > Background > Fill and choose your preferred background colour.

Why Customization

Customization on SwiftXR is designed to help you build flexible, reusable XR product experiences. Instead of creating multiple projects for small changes, you can configure variations within a single experience.

This approach saves time and allows XR experiences to scale across products, teams, and campaigns. Get started today and create your first product customization project at swiftxr.ioarrow-up-right

Last updated